Building or bludgeoning the housing crisis?

One of Ireland’s biggest issues is not getting jobs for the people that live here but getting somewhere for them to live. To get rents and house prices down is to build more homes but that’s a slow and often weather-dependent process.

Could offsite construction speed things up? For more on this Joe spoke to John O’Shaughnessy Managing Director of Clancy Construction.
